Corrected Hole in Heart, 25 Years On

Corrected Hole in Heart, 25 Years On

I'm 32, male. Had a corrective surgery for hole in heart about 25 years ago, don't exercise but not too much overweight.

I've had series of cramps to the left side of the chest for the past 2 years with the most recent one happening just minutes before my posting, which actualy prompted me to search for heart attack symptoms. I easily get cramps to my calves when i stretch which i believe could be due to old soccer injury or maybe cholesterol. I havent done any checkup in years except for visit to general practitioners.

My question, is the cramp to the left chest a symptom of heart attack / angina?

I have had lots of angina in the past, so I know how, in general, how angina is experienced in men. I have never heard of angina being experienced as a cramp in the chest. I could surely be wrong though.

The important thing to me is that you have a history of a congenital heart defect, that ~25% of the population have. ( Isn't that amazing?) So you need to get to a cardiologist and have an echocardiogram to see if the PFO is still "fixed", and to collect all the other great data that a good echocardiogram reveals.

Your symptoms do not match those with the literature, but a young man of 30 in a hospital bed beside me, had PFO since birth and had had chest pains for 1 month. I believe that they were going to do a cardiac implant via catheterization to close the hole.

Here is a good explanation of the procedure that you might well need again:

Your chest cramps may be due to an unbalance in your blood electrolytes, such as low magnesium, potassium, calcium etc. It is just your history that makes it essential for you to have an echocardiogram soon.
